Hell of a Lady
A spirited debutante and a reluctant earl find salvation in love
Miss Rhododendron Mossant has given up on men, love, and worst of all, herself. Once a flirtatious beauty, the nightmares of her past have frozen her in fear. Ruined and ready to call it quits, all she can hope for is divine intervention.
Justin White, Vicar turned Earl, has the looks of an angel but the heart of a rake. He isn't prepared to marry and yet honor won't allow anything less. Which poses something of a problem... because, by God, when it comes to this vixen, a war is is waging between his body and his soul.
She’s hopeless and he’s hopelessly devoted. Together they must conquer the ton, her disgrace, and his empty pockets. With a little deviousness, and a miracle or two, is it possible this devilish match was really made in heaven?
Book 4 in the Devilish Debutantes Series

Nobody's Lady
A second chance at love for a duke and a London widow…
THE DUKE — After managing a dukedom and serving in the House of Lords for nearly a decade, Michael Cortland has finally become betrothed to the perfect lady, Natalie Spencer. While traveling to London for the 1824 parliamentary season however, a highway robbery leaves him stranded and mired in mud. All of his strategic plans are called into question when his first love happens along to “rescue” him.
THE WIDOW — Thankfully widowed after enduring a forced marriage for eight years, Lilly Beauchamp is returning to London to present her stepdaughter to society. Unable to resist, she finds herself aiding the man who betrayed her years ago. As the facts behind their estrangement emerge however, blame shifts and passions are reignited.
Amidst political and social intrigue, Lilly discovers her inner strengths while Michael reconciles a gentleman’s honor with his heart’s desire and his conscience. Falling in love all over again, new challenges face the star-crossed lovers. There is a choice after all, but do they have the strength and courage to choose each other?
Book 1 of the Lord Love a Lady Series

Lady Saves the Duke
The Duke of Ice, a mousy miss, and a wardrobe malfunction…
Alex Cross, the Duke of "Ice" has more than earned the nickname given him by the ton. Having lost his family in a tragic accident a few years before, he is now cynical, blasé and arrogant. The duke no longer expects happiness, but will not reject sensual pleasure if it is offered. After all, a man has needs...
...none of which will be met, unfortunately, at this particular house party. For most of his fellow guests are either elderly gossips or stodgy old codgers and the entertainments thus far have been something of a snooze, really: parlor games, nature walks, etc... etc...
And if all that isn’t enough to send him running, his host expects him to court his recently jilted daughter, the simpering miss, Lady Natalie. Oh, hell no! He'll make his excuses and depart early. Perhaps he will return to London to replace his mistress. He'd had to relinquish Elise after she'd become cloying and possessive.
He fails to escape, however, before Miss Abigail Wright arrives. The barely genteel lady smiles too often, laughs too easily, and is far too optimistic for her own good. And after she experiences a most unfortunate wardrobe malfunction, the Duke of Ice reluctantly finds himself sexually attracted to her.
That’s when the trouble begins.
Because a House Party Scandal spreads like wild fire and if the duke wishes to save Miss Wright’s reputation, he’ll have to make her a respectable offer. She's just a mouse of a thing really. What harm can there be in marrying the poor gal and then leaving her to rusticate in the country?
What harm indeed.
Book 3 in the Lord Love a Lady Series
